1. Garmin Venu 3 – Best Overall Fitness Tracker

The Garmin Venu 3 stands out for its versatility and accuracy. Equipped with advanced GPS and heart rate sensors, it offers features like Body Battery, Recovery Time, and detailed sleep tracking. With up to 14 days of battery life, this smartwatch is perfect for users who want a comprehensive health and fitness companion.
Key Features:
- Highly accurate multi-band GNSS.
- Sleep coaching and nap detection.
- FDA-approved ECG app for heart health monitoring.
- Mobile payments and voice assistant support.
Pros:
- Exceptional accuracy across metrics.
- Long battery life.
- Stylish design with multiple size options.
Cons:
- Premium price point.

How to Choose the Right Fitness Tracker
When selecting a fitness tracker, consider the following:
- Activity Type: Are you a runner, swimmer, or casual gym-goer?
- Features: Look for metrics like heart rate, sleep tracking, and GPS.
- Budget: Premium models offer advanced features, but budget-friendly options can still meet basic needs.
- Compatibility: Ensure the tracker works seamlessly with your smartphone or other devices.
